The Evolution of Typography: From Tradition to Innovation
Typography has always played a crucial role in shaping how we perceive information. From the ornate lettering of historical signs to the sleek, minimalist designs of today, the evolution of typefaces reflects broader cultural and technological shifts. Reler is a prime example of this transition, drawing inspiration from the hand-painted signs of the past while adapting to contemporary design practices.
Traditional sign painting was known for its craftsmanship and artistry, often featuring bold, readable letters that could be seen from a distance. These characteristics have influenced many modern fonts, but Reler takes this legacy a step further by infusing it with a clean, geometric structure. This results in a typeface that is not only visually striking but also highly functional across various mediums.
